Italian Idioms

Idioms can rarely be translated word for word — but the pictures they paint stick in your mind. In bocca al lupo literally means "into the wolf's mouth" — and means "good luck!". The correct reply is "crepi!" ("may (the wolf) drop dead!"). Here Marina learns the most common modi di dire.

Idiom Literally Actual meaning
In bocca al lupo! into the wolf's mouth good luck!
Non vedo l'ora I don't see the hour I can't wait
Costare un occhio della testa to cost an eye out of your head to cost a fortune
Essere al verde to be at the green to be broke
Toccare ferro to touch iron to knock on wood
Fare il ponte to make the bridge to take a long weekend
